What's your study plan? I'm starting with videos that cover content areas that I feel that I am weak in. I want to do about 1 video a day making sure I know the content " without a doubt and hesitation "( which should take about 2 weeks ) and then spend the month of June doing questions from exam cram, PDA, Kaplan qtrainers/test bank, and possibly saunders. I don't have a date yet for the boards, but I'm thinking early July.

Hopefully between this course, LaCharity P-D-A, Exam Cram, NCLEX 3500 (online link), Kaplan Stategies book, and Saunders for reference I can pass as I am a multi-time Nclex tester and being out of school for almost two years. Reading on this site is how I found out about LaCharity, Exam Cram, and Hurst. I plan on reviewing the content from Hurst until I know it "without a doubt or hesitation" and then taking my boards for the last time and passing! I work graveyard at a State Psychiatric Unit so most nights I can get through one section along with doing 50-100 questions, then I review the Hurst lecture again when i get home in the AM.
